I agree with what you said but my quote is about the fact that the guy sculpting and painting these toys is not one of the makers that hypes his stuff and sells for maximum profit just to push the aftermarket value. He gets compared with Nag because of the style of the sculpt but it's not a fair comparison at all. He was selling for a slightly high but reasonable price from the beginning and once collectors and flippers started reselling his stuff for loads of cash he didn't raise his prices. He still trades for other people toys. Still lets people get their hands on blanks. The only real change is that he occasionally auctions his own one-off pieces himself. So when I said he could charge double because of the hype it was simply to point out that he isn't one of the people who does that kind of thing. Maybe at some point that will change but from what I know it hasn't yet so the guy deserves a little credit for not intentionally creating or feeding that side of collecting japanese toys. Even if you think his stuff is "hyped up derivative crap".
